Deciphering KNX Device Data Transfer Protocols

The KNX protocol is a widely adopted standard for home and building automation. To successfully control appliances, understanding its communication protocols is imperative. KNX relies on a layered architecture, with each layer having specific roles. At the lowest layer, physical interaction takes place over two-wire bus systems. As you move up the layers, KNX devices can transfer data using various arrangements, including binary and textual formats.

  • KNX communication protocols support both single device management as well as complex system-wide processes.
  • One key aspect of KNX is its resilience thanks to error detection and correction tools.
  • To facilitate interoperability between devices from different vendors, KNX adheres to strict guidelines.

Resolving KNX Devices

When encountering issues with your KNX devices, it's essential to perform thorough troubleshooting and diagnostics. A systematic approach can help you pinpoint the root cause of the problem and implement a suitable solution. Begin by observing the symptoms carefully. Note down any error messages, unusual behavior, or deviations in device functionality. Consult the KNX documentation and user manuals for recommendations on common issues and their resolutions. Deploy specialized diagnostic tools available for KNX systems to record device communication, identify faulty components, or examine network performance. Remember to document your findings and steps taken during the troubleshooting process. This can be invaluable for future reference and assistance with experts if needed.

Top KNX Device Manufacturers: A Comparative Analysis

The KNX standard has achieved itself as a favored choice for smart home and building automation systems. With its far-reaching range of compatible devices, KNX offers outstanding flexibility and control. To navigate the diverse territory of KNX manufacturers, this article provides a comparative analysis of some of the most reputable players in the industry.

Including well-known global brands to focused companies, we'll analyze their product portfolios, talents, and concentrated markets. Whether you are a organizational user or a system integrator, this analysis will equip you in making intelligent decisions when selecting KNX devices for your next project.

  • ABB is celebrated for its broad range of KNX products, spanning from lighting control to energy management.
  • Siemens offers a solid portfolio of KNX solutions, including receivers for building automation and security systems.
  • GIRA is well-regarded for its contemporary KNX displays that seamlessly integrate into modern living spaces.
